Output ee40e415cc457184f3d7776af84d25fb1b99757a10e3339e6885b9062cfb0de6:5

value
23399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f43578a89e832a3b32735080cc830dd5f0ce159 OP_EQUAL
address
3K8KfBfHhtSTCTRizKdrYWYyfWPvRd5dnk
transaction
ee40e415cc457184f3d7776af84d25fb1b99757a10e3339e6885b9062cfb0de6